A break from the heat has finally come to the east coast and with it also comes a bit of a break in the onslaught of new music. Still, this week has some big names making awaited returns. Earlier this year, Childish Gambino gave us his finalized version of Altavista and this week he’s dropping Bando Stone & The New World, Donald Glover’s final project under the Gambino moniker.
Indie twee group Los Campesinos! have been highly influential on some of the more up and comping bands that bring the urgency of emo with classic indie rock hallmarks and they’re back to chime in on a scene and sound that that helped create.
In 2021, Dr. Dog called it quits from touring, but said they’d continue on as a band. Today they follow-up on that promise with their first new studio album since 2018 which marks the longest gap between albums in their career.
After they quietly dropped off some festivals a few years ago, I assumed Japandroids had quietly called it quits. Well, this week they announced one final victory lap with a fourth and final album due this fall. The first single “Chicago” is a classic sounding Japandroids tune with high-flying riffs and the whoa-oh-oh attitude that begs for a sweaty sing-a-long moment.
Noise rock quartet Chat Pile pulverized the world with their forceful debut record God’s Country and this fall they’ll follow it up with a punishing new record that seems to sum up the current, desperate state of worldly affairs. The lead single “I am Dog Now” is a guttural slog of blistering heat full of primal energy that demands attention.
Following the untimely death of Mimi Sparhark, the band Low came to a sad end. However her partner Alan Sparhark is continuing on with a solo career that seems to keep the spirit of his late band alive with minimal compositions of beautiful noise and his first single gives us an early taste of what he’s cooked up for his solo debut.
Youth has always been the fifth member of The Linda Lindas but as they slowly edge out of that phase of their career, they’ve announced their sophomore record and the first single still hones in on their young spirit of rambunctious, yet sophisticated pop-punk that signals a great future ahead of them.
Earlier in the year, Wild Pink released a great three-song EP that took their dreamy guitar splendor on an extended journey of grandeur and they’re set to follow it up with a full length later in the year. The first single is another glowing track that highlights their sprawling sound with wondrous success.
